AUY2K -> Scenario #1 (3/7/2003 2:34:44 AM)

I am new to UV and I just completed Scenario 1 on hystorical level. Before this I played Scenario 1 on easy and I won pretty easily so I thought I would bump it up a notch.

First off it was a marginal victory I only won by 100 points or so. The biggest battle was at Gili Gili. The Japanese had a big landing force plus they had a tough looking TF with 3 CVs. I managed to keep Gili Gili in tact but my CVs were damaged and were pretty much out of the game. I thought for sure I would lose because of the damage sustained just from that one battle...but the Japanese really never threatened again for the rest of the scenario.

Does this sound pretty common for this scenario? Do the Japanese put up one good fight and then retire?




Mr.Frag -> (3/7/2003 2:57:25 AM)

The odds are somewhat stacked in Japan's favour.

Rachet up the skill level another notch and try again. Since the AI is not quite as smart as us, we need to give it an edge.

Based on the short duration of Scenario 1, there is really only time for the one major engagement. It will pretty much determine the outcome of the scenario.

The fact that your CV's were still floating is a good thing. History was not quite so lucky.
